Auto Correct and Me

Below is the complex sentence that fetched Marcel Fernandes Filho the Guinness World Record of "Fastest touch-screen text message record". His record time was 18.19 seconds.

"The razor-toothed piranhas of the genera Serrasalmus and Pygocentrus are the most ferocious freshwater fish in the world. In reality they seldom attack a human." (This statement was copied from the Guinness World Records website)


I am not sure if he was troubled by the menace of my text typing life, "Auto-Correct". When it comes to typing on the mobile I have the speed of the slowest sloth in the world. Add to that the constant typos. If my speed and typos were not enough to frustrate me, the mobile throws at me it's "know-it-all" attitude with the Auto-Correct feature. Every time I try to type a message in my regional language Mr. Mobile is not happy about it. He forcibly auto-corrects my text to something that he is comfortable with. Now, that is what I call encroaching my privacy. Allow me to write my message in my language, the way I wish to. Stop being such a snob, Mr. Mobile. But he would not pay heed to my requests. Recently, I learnt a way to get rid of the auto-correct. Life is better and I am happier.

I know this is a very mundane thing to even discuss about. Let me share it with a different perspective.

Just like I do not like "Auto-Correct" in my mobile, I do not like a person with "know-it-all" attitude in my human world. Someone who always tries to correct me with the slightest of mistake. Someone who does not provide me the space to falter and learn from mistakes. I rather prefer guidance over constant correction. I have my way of doing things and I respect your way too Mr/Miss Human-Auto-Correct. But you should understand that just like you were given a chance to "know-it-all", you should give that space to others too.

Bottom line for me is that I will commit mistakes, I will fail but let me write my story on the wall. Please don't correct my story of failures with your favourite words.
